Kaliningrad trains to run for three more weeks but their future fickle
Photo: Pexel. Angelina Zhang.
The issue of train transit between Russia and Kaliningrad via Lithuania seems to be reaching some kind of stability. After consulting with the Financial Crimes Investigation Service (FNTT), Lithuanian Railways managed to secure a three-week-long pre-payment for Russian transit services.
